Martirosian Eliminates Ramos

Nível 25 : 50,000/100,000, 15,000 ante
Martirosian wins
Martirosian wins

The sixth time might be the charm for Artur Martirosian as he busted another player in Dennys Ramos to stay in the top of the standings. Preflop, Martorisian raised to 200,000 and Ramos defended the big blind.

Ramos check-called bets of 100,000 on the {9-Hearts}{2-Hearts}{a-Clubs} flop and 150,000 on the {k-Clubs} turn before another {k-Spades} fell on the river. Ramos checked a third time, Martirosian moved all in and Ramos called it off for 659,961 total.

Martirosian showed him the bad news with {k-Hearts}{8-Hearts} and Ramos mucked {a-Diamonds}{6-Diamonds}.

Peters Snipes Two

Nível 23 : 30,000/60,000, 9,000 ante
Peters takes down two
Peters takes down two

Bullet holes galore over at David Peters' table with the American taking down both Connor Drinan and Bruno Volkmann to bring the field to 13.

In the first hand, Peters shoved from the cutoff with {a-Spades}{9-Clubs} and Drinan called with {a-Hearts}{7-Diamonds} in the big blind. The board ran out {4-Diamonds}{k-Hearts}{q-Hearts}{8-Clubs}{a-Clubs} to see the nine kicker play and end Drinan's bid.

Against Volkmann, it was an old-fashioned coin flip with the {8-Spades}{8-Clubs} of Peters duking it out with Volkmann's {a-Hearts}{k-Clubs}. The {4-Spades}{7-Hearts}{6-Clubs}{10-Hearts}{4-Hearts} board brought no needed paint for Volkmann.

Malinowski Axes Nixon, Martirosian Takes Some Souls

Nível 23 : 30,000/60,000, 9,000 ante

Artur Martirosian won a three-way all in with {q-Hearts}{8-Hearts} to send both Christian Jeppsson and Bert Stevens to the rail. After that table broke next, leaving the field with two tables, it was Wiktor Malinowski who got it in with {4-Diamonds}{4-Hearts} against the {a-Spades}{7-Diamonds} of Jon Nixon.

The {6-Clubs}{8-Diamonds}{k-Diamonds}{8-Hearts}{q-Spades} board favored Malinowski to knock out Nixon in 16th place.

Smolka Keeps Crushing

Nível 22 : 25,000/50,000, 7,500 ante

Dawid Smolka has been on an absolute tear as of late and just sent "IneedWasabi" to the rail to soar to 6M. Smolka got {q-Diamonds}{q-Spades} preflop all-in against "IneedWasabi"'s {a-Spades}{j-Hearts} and the ladies stayed ahead during the {j-Clubs}{6-Spades}{3-Clubs}{4-Hearts}{k-Hearts} rundown.
